"The Leader as Communicator examines the many communication-based roles you must master in order to maximize your effectiveness as a leader." "The Leader as Communicator presents case studies from companies including Cadillac, Emerson, and Saturn, plus dozens of examples from organizations like GE, the U.S. Army, the St. Louis Cardinals baseball team, and others. Sprinkled throughout the text are provocative quotations from Peter Drucker, Warren Bennis, Louis Gerstner, Jac Fitz-enz, William Bridges, and many other leadership experts and executives." "Packed with strategies and tactics for shaping the communications climate of your organization, the book culminates with assessment exercises that let you measure your own communication skills. You'll then know just how and where to apply specific techniques to build morale, creativity, alignment, and productivity across your entire company."--BOOK JACKET.
